VDOT Park and Ride Lot Finder Online

VDOT:
“Currently there are 21 Park & Ride lots in the Thomas Jefferson Planning District.  However, if you are traveling in other areas of Virginia, you may be interested in the Park & Ride resource center provided by VDOT. This resource center was created by VDOT in close partnership with the Virginia Department of Rail and Public Transportation (DRPT) and Virginia’s commuter resource agencies to better serve commuters, travelers and the communities across the Commonwealth. There are over 300 Virginia P&R lots available for your use, including state-owned, privately-owned and informal lots.

On their website, VDOT provides tools for easily locating Park & Ride lot locations and information as well as tips and resources on ridesharing. Users can search for a lot using an interactive map, clicking on a region in Virginia or searching by ZIP code.”
